    @bigs1546 3 года назад +13

    From their album "Kick" - I think everyone in Australia owned a copy when it came out in 1987! That album had 4 Top 10 hits [that is in the USA not just Australia] this one 'Need You Tonight', 'Devil Inside', 'Never Tear Us Apart', and 'New Sensation' - all great tracks - also check out 'Suicide Blonde' from their album " X " , that was from 1990. And as we say here in Oz do yourself a favour - check them all out plus the rest that I am sure are also recommended in the comments - was a great band - and all the ladies loved Michael.

    @annacostanzo5307 3 года назад +18

    INXS opened and toured with QUEEN.. INXS Said they learned a lot about the music industry and touring from Queen, like how to treat opening bands… Because Freddie Mercury and Brian May were so helpful and encouraging. And INXS was also close friends with U2, In fact Bono wrote a song about Michael Hutchins after his death.…”Stuck in a Moment You Can’t Get Out Of”

    It's pronounced "In Excess". They were an Aussie band, one of our biggest, and were at their career height in the 80s and 90s. They sold 70 million albums worldwide, but sadly, their lead singer Michael Hutchence was found dead in his hotel room after sadly taking his own life in 1997 at the age of 37. The band also comprised of 3 brothers: Tim, Andrew and John Farriss. Andrew, along with Michael, wrote a good number of songs for the band, including this one, as well as "Suicide Blonde", "Original Sin" and "Never tear us apart".
    If you want to check out more of their songs, I would advise you check out their album Kick, which was their biggest seller.
